Guys, there's nothing to maintain here.
There is not just one MediaPack - there can be as many as 2-per-week!!
Just as long as there's a permanent download location we can put into the distribution-tool anyone can prepare a MediaPack. The idea is that a single package reflects some form of theme - it doesn't have to, but that's the general idea - like 3 maps in a city-theme, or 20 textures for a ghetto-style (lots of grafitti) .. or 2 models of bicycles .. anything goes. Just read up on, and ask for further details, what the MediaPack is about.

The discussion as we wrote the code took a similar path, hamolton. We decided the proper thing to do, would be, that the infrastructure-tool would provide you with the option to download single packages, combos (prepared or on-the-fly) and always the grand-deluxe-ALLinONE-package.
But since there's has only ever been one big map-MediaPack ..
.. the tool and code currently haven't progressed anymore towards optimum user-friendliness since it's been a feature that was neglected by the community. Just look at the feebleness of the documentation.

This thread is the first that a large number of people have started discussing the feature. A hopeful sign for progress, I dare to hope.
The engine can already read ZIPs, so it's logical that - at some point - the triggering of a MediaPack-header-field in the map just loaded, could be, that the engine does a HTTP-get (like the old masterserver retrieval) and thus downloads the mediapack. Then an on-the-fly unpacking and putting into the game-home-dir; running the package-config .. e voila .. you have the required media for the map.
For now it's a tedious job of extracting URL(s) from your log and then getting each one, for an instant download of the package - the engine gives you HOST?PACKAGE-ID=%d-urls - where these have individual entries for hoster-information (read: the URL where the file actually lies .. each package can come from one totally individual URL).

mediapacks are already part of v1104.
mediapacks contain a number of files. these can be textures and/or models and/or maps and/or txt|cfg|..-files ... just one group or, if a map requires models - for example - then those too, but if these models already come in another mediapack then it won't be listed as a requirement.
you see, they build up on one another.
you have pak-#3207 and that's great .. then someone has done something that requires pak-#4410 and pak-#4412 .. you get the output, you download, you unpack, you restart the map .. (the latter bit was mainly out-of-the-game-doing-it-yourself) .. and then you can keep on playing.
If you then build a map with textures used that occur in pak-#4410 and pak-#3207 then those two will be in the header of your map .. if you see, we've currently omitted any textures from pak-#4412 .. the 3rd-party won't need it for that map.
